Abstract submission for the 43rd World Hospital Congress now open
The 43rd World Hospital Congress of the International Hospital Federation opens its call for paper presentations and posters, inviting professionals from hospitals and health service delivery organizations to submit their abstracts.
The International Hospital Federation and the Ministry of Health of the Sultanate of Oman, organizers of the 43rd World Hospital Congress, are inviting health leaders and professionals to submit abstracts for an opportunity to showcase their work at the next congress being held in Muscat, Oman on 7-9 November 2019.
The IHF World Hospital Congress is a unique global forum that brings together leaders of national and international hospital and healthcare organizations. Through this event multi-disciplinary exchange of knowledge, expertise and experiences are facilitated, together with dialogue on best practices in leadership in hospital and healthcare management and delivery of services.
The 2019 Congress will tackle the overarching theme “People at the heart of health services in peace and crisis”.
Those interested to present their work to the international healthcare community in a session or as a poster can submit an abstract online against the following sub-themes:
1. Resilient health services
2. Innovation for health impact
3. Health investment for prosperity
Chosen abstracts will also be considered for publication in the IHF Journal and present in an IHF Webinar.
Deadline of abstracts is on 15 February 2019.

About the International Hospital Federation (IHF)
Established in 1929, the IHF is an international not for profit, non-governmental membership organization. Its members are worldwide hospitals and healthcare organizations having a distinct relationship with the provision of healthcare. IHF provides its members with a platform for the exchange of knowledge and strategic experience as well as opportunities for international collaborations with different actors in the health sector. IHF recognizes the essential role of hospitals and health care organizations in providing health care, supporting health services and offering education. Its role is to help international hospitals work towards improving the level of the services they deliver to the population with the primary goal of improving the health of society. www.ihf-fih.org
